What’s Inter Milan’s plan to stop Lamine Yamal? Coach Simone Inzaghi reveals | Football News

Lamine Yamal, who became the youngest player ever to score in a Champions League semifinal in the first leg had exasperated Inter Milan so much that its coach Simone Inzaghi had admitted how he had to take the risk of putting three players around him.
“I’ve never seen a player like Lamine Yamal in the last 8-9 years. We had to put three on him and, obviously, spaces opened up elsewhere,” he had told Prime Video.
“He caused us huge problems, as we had to double up the marking every time, it wasn’t enough, so tripling up we’d leave gaps elsewhere and were forced to sit deeper.

In a press conference on May 5, Inzaghi was asked about Yamal again.
“We have to try to keep the ball from getting to him, but not always possible,” he told reporters.
“He will obviously be double-marked, he’ll be a marked man, and we’ll try to pay close attention to him.
“Seeing him live, he’s an incredible talent, truly very dangerous — everyone gives him the ball. But it’s complicated, what struck me about him live was his speed of thought, even before receiving the ball he already knows what to do”.Story continues below this ad
Inter Milan defender Alessandro Bastoni was also quoted the publication Di Marzio on Yamal.
“He is the strongest I have ever played against. I was impressed the level he has reached, in terms of ability to create chances he is the best. How can we stop him? We will have to do as we did in the first leg, double and triple him. Barcelona is not just Yamal, they have an enviable offensive department .”
After playing 3-3 draw in the first leg of semi- final, Barcelona and Inter Milan will face each other in the second leg on Wednesday.
